How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Grand Haven?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Grand Haven Luxury Studio Apartments | $1,139 | $835 | $1,300 |
| Grand Haven Luxury 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,461 | $841 | $4,917 |
| Grand Haven Luxury 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,706 | $970 | $3,500 |
| Grand Haven Luxury 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,864 | $1,147 | $5,237 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Grand Haven
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Grand Haven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Grand Haven ranges from $841 to $4,917 with an average monthly rent of $1,461.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Grand Haven c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Grand Haven range from $970 to $3,500.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,706.
How expensive are Grand Haven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 21 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Grand Haven on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,147 to $5,237 - averaging $1,864 for the location.
